1969 48ft Rampart , Napa, USA

This boat was recently advertised in the USA but it appears that it has now been sold. It was described as follows :

This rare vessel cruised throughout the Mediterranean where it was eventually shipped from Genoa to Oakland where it cruised the Delta for a few years. She spent several years in Lockhaven Washington before finally ending up in Napa. She was refit in 2008 and is currently in a covered slip at Napa Valley Marina. She would make a very comfortable liveaboard with full galley, 3 staterooms and two steering stations.
